Deep Sea Cable Incident Prompts NATO Response

The incident involving a deep-sea communications cable has initiated a significant response from the North Atlantic Treaty Organization, marking a notable shift in how the alliance addresses threats to critical infrastructure. While the specific location and nature of the damage are still under investigation, the incident has prompted serious discussions about the vulnerability of the vast network of underwater cables that form the backbone of global internet and telecommunications. These cables, often laid across thousands of miles of ocean floor, are essential for international financial transactions, data transfers, and overall connectivity. The sheer scale of the network and the difficulty in monitoring it present unique security challenges. This incident highlights the potential for deliberate attacks to disrupt vital communication channels, which could have far-reaching consequences for economies and societies worldwide. The North Atlantic Treaty Organization has characterized the cable damage as a potential threat to the security of its member nations.

The deep-sea cable network is an intricate and extensive system, consisting of hundreds of thousands of kilometers of fiber optic cables that carry almost all transoceanic internet traffic. These cables are usually owned and operated by private telecommunications companies, with governments often having limited oversight. The sheer volume of cable traffic has only increased in recent years, as data consumption has grown, and international reliance on digital communication has become paramount. This makes these cables increasingly attractive targets for malicious actors. While accidental damage, often from ships’ anchors or natural disasters, does occur, the possibility of deliberate sabotage has brought a heightened level of concern amongst governments and intelligence agencies. The response from NATO indicates that the potential implications of an intentional attack are being taken extremely seriously. The alliance, historically focused on military defense, is now expanding its security portfolio to include critical infrastructure protection, recognizing the importance of these assets in today’s interconnected world.
